Abstract
A method, and an apparatus, for self-interference suppression in a relay for wireless communication, wherein the relay is arranged for receiving a signal r(n) transmitted from a transmitter, and for transmitting a self-interference suppressed transmit signal xr(n) to a receiver. The self-interference suppressed transmit signal xr(n) is achieved by determining a receive suppression filter matrix Wr, determining a relay amplification matrix G, and determining a transmit suppression filter matrix Wt, and then applying the suppression filters and the amplification matrix to the received signal r(n).
